#d06dfe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d06dfe is composed of 81.6% red, 42.7%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.1% cyan, 57.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 281 degrees, a saturation of 98.6% and a lightness of 71.2%. #d06dfe color hex could be obtained by blending #ffdaff with #a100fd.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

Shades and Tints of #d06dfe
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#07000a is the darkest color, while #fcf5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#d06dfe
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b7b1ba is the less saturated color, while #d06dfe is the most saturated one.
